soluti<strong>on</strong> to <strong>the</strong> <strong>crisis</strong> <strong>in</strong> Zaire needs to be c<strong>on</strong>sidered regi<strong>on</strong>ally. For <strong>in</strong>stance, should <strong>the</strong> <strong>crisis</strong><br />

<strong>in</strong> Zaire be resolved and a new str<strong>on</strong>ger Zaire emerge under a democratic government, it<br />

could <strong>in</strong>crease <strong>the</strong> propensity of <strong>in</strong>terstate war <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> regi<strong>on</strong>, given <strong>the</strong> historic animosity<br />

am<strong>on</strong>g <strong>the</strong> states <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> regi<strong>on</strong> and <strong>the</strong> fact that <strong>the</strong>re are several unsettled territorial claims.<br />

Thus, <strong>the</strong> <strong>crisis</strong> <strong>in</strong> Zaire will <strong>on</strong>ly be fully settled if <strong>the</strong> situati<strong>on</strong> <strong>in</strong>side Rwanda, Burundi,<br />

Uganda and Tanzania can also be resolved. This is a tall diplomatic order. However, unless a<br />

holistic regi<strong>on</strong>al approach is followed, violent c<strong>on</strong>flict will c<strong>on</strong>t<strong>in</strong>ue to plague <strong>the</strong> Great Lakes<br />

regi<strong>on</strong>.<br />
